CONDUCTING CONTRACTS BETWEEN PILOTS
Note: To successfully initiate a contracts between two pilots, it is important for the parties to complete the following steps in the order listed.
1. Contractor - TAGET CONTRACTEE (T)
2. Contractee - TARGET CONTRACTOR (T)
3. Contractor - SEND TRADE REQUEST (F4)
4. Contractee - ACCEPT TRADE REQUEST (F4)
5. Contractor - DETERMINE REWARD6. Contract Type - CYCLE TO SELECT OPTION
- a. "Arrange Contract" Button - SELECT
b. "Cash" Button - SELECT
c. "Enter Amount" Window - INPUT CREDIT PAYOUT
d. Correct Amount Offered - CHECK & PRESS ENTER7. Contractee - PRESS "ACCEPT" BUTTON
- a. Destroy Player - SELECT NAME OF TARGET
b. Destroy Hostiles - SELECT TOTAL NUMBER
c. Recover Materials - SELECT TYPE OF MATERIAL
- Platinum Units
Biological Units
Oxygen Units
Gold Units
Silver Units
Water Units
Metal Alloys
Diamonds
8. Contract - CHECK9. Contractee - COMPLETE THE CONTRACT
- a. Inventory Console - OPEN (F3)
b. Trade Contract Description - CHECK
10. Trade Contract Completed - CHECKNote: For "Recover Materials" contracts, pilots need to perform a standard Trade in order to complete the contract.
- a. Credits Paid Out - CHECK
b. Credits Received - CHECK
c. Current Pilot(s) Status - AUTO SAVED

(Warning: Wall Of Text Ahead)
If this discussion was happening pre-expansion, I would be against the removal/tweaking of FTs based two virtues: combat in the game was easy enough as it was, and FTs make fantastic trading goods (as anyone who spends time trading quickly finds out)
However, post-expansion content and tweaks have changed a lot of things. There are other options for high-value missile hardpoint items (the fuel, charge, and shield packs), and now combat is actually challenging and a great deal of fun. The only virtue FTs really have left is that they make a really big, really pretty explosion (which if you're suiciding with them, you don't really get to enjoy that). At this point, some of the only things I can think of to rationalize their continued existence within the game are:
a)they are still valuable trading items
b)FTs are present within the lore of the game as cap-ship killers, and it wouldn't make sense for them to just kind of "vanish", even if that would be the quickest solution.
So, in an effort to contribute to the discussion, I'ma just throw in my two cents as to how the FT situation could be mitigated. In regards to their presence within the lore of the game, and their intended role as cap ship destroying weapons, why is it that they only take up as much room as a regular missile? For the size of the explosion they make, I find it kind of funny that they're supposedly the same size as a Starfire or Exodus missile. You'd think something like that would take up a lot more room for the kind of payload that an FT delivers. I would propose that an FT would take up multiple, or even all of a ship's missile hardpoints, limiting how many a ship can carry at a time.
However, limiting how many FTs a ship could have at one time still wouldn't solve their abuse when used in suicide tactics. At best, it would just limit it a little more. How else could the use of FTs against small targets be discouraged? I refer again to the weapon's in-universe role as an anti capital ship weapon. Short of a direct hit, I can't see a reason why the FT would detonate. I would imagine that it's function would be to penetrate the a capital ship's hull and THEN detonate, rather than just detonating on contact or after a set amount of time. If there's no direct hit to activate this supposed detonation mechanism within the FT, why would it go off at all?
Now, the problem with both of those solutions is that, on the slim chance that they would be considered, they would represent what I can only assume is a prohibitive amount of work on Vice's part. I'm a writer, coding is a bit beyond my ken, so I don't actually know if that would be the case. Regardless, if FTs are to be overhauled, tweaked, or even straight up removed, I would like it if the fuel, charge, and shield packs became a bit more common to compensate for their absence/reduced availability. Mostly because I'd need something else to fill my hardpoints with for trade runs
